England’s tour of Sri Lanka and India offers them a last chance to qualify for the World Test Championship final. Currently, they are fourth on the list after Australia, India and New Zealand, They were successful in their last three test series with South Africa, West Indies, and Pakistan but they need to earn more points to qualify for the finals which will take place at Lord’s in June.
Their schedule, for now, involves six Test matches and they have to try to win as many of them as possible. Though their competitors are in a better position right now, New Zealand if they beat Pakistan in the second test will surpass India to take second place, but India still has 6 Test matches in hand to gain points and is currently favored to reach the finals with Australia.
